📰 What's Happening

In August 2026, ICICI Bank raised $1 billion via senior unsecured fixed rate notes under its $7.5 billion medium-term note program, with plans to list the instruments internationally (Filing: GENERAL | 2026-08-27). This follows a series of capital-raising and employee stock option allocations in August 2026, including 48,983 shares under ESOP-2022 and 181,843 shares under ESOP-2000 (Filing: CORPORATE ACTION | 2026-08-27 and BOARD MEETING | 2026-08-24). Additionally, the bank scheduled an in-person investor meeting with Elara India on September 2, 2026, to discuss its strategic outlook (Filing: GENERAL | 2026-08-28). These actions reflect a deliberate focus on capital management, investor communication, and workforce incentives.

Operating performance has shown steady improvement over the last four quarters, with revenue growing from ₹48,181 Cr in September 2025 to ₹52,241 Cr in June 2026, while operating profit margin stabilized around 28%. Net profit rose from ₹13,411 Cr to ₹16,210 Cr over the same period, supporting EPS growth from ₹17.54 to ₹21.54. This upward trend aligns with management's focus on operational efficiency and credit quality, although operating profit growth has moderated compared to the sharp 43.4% margin seen in June 2025, suggesting a normalization after a one-time benefit.

⚠️ Risk Factors

1. Rising institutional ownership may increase volatility if large investors rebalance portfolios. 2. Margin expansion has slowed from the exceptional 43.4% level seen in mid-2025, potentially exposing the bank to margin pressure if cost control weakens. 3. The continued use of ESOPs to compensate employees increases share dilution, which could pressure per-share metrics over time. 4. International debt issuance, while low-cost, adds foreign exchange and refinancing risk if global rates remain elevated.
